#include "simulator.h"
#include <iostream>
#include <fstream>
#include <iomanip>
uint64_t timestamp = 0;
double sc_time_stamp() {
return timestamp;
}
Simulator::Simulator() {
// force random values for unitialized signals
const char* args[] = {"", "+verilator+rand+reset+2", "+verilator+seed+50"};
Verilated::commandArgs(3, args);
vortex_ = new Vvortex_afu_sim();
#ifdef VCD_OUTPUT
Verilated::traceEverOn(true);
trace_ = new VerilatedVcdC;
trace_->set_time_unit("1ns");
vortex_->trace(trace_, 99);
trace_->open("trace.vcd");
#endif
}
Simulator::~Simulator() {
#ifdef VCD_OUTPUT
trace_->close();
#endif
delete vortex_;
}
void Simulator::reset() {
#ifndef NDEBUG
std::cout << timestamp << ": [sim] reset()" << std::endl;
#endif
vortex_->reset = 1;
this->step();
vortex_->reset = 0;
dram_rsp_vec_.clear();
}
void Simulator::step() {
vortex_->clk = 0;
this->eval();
vortex_->clk = 1;
this->eval();
avs_driver();
ccip_driver();
}
void Simulator::eval() {
vortex_->eval();
#ifdef VCD_OUTPUT
trace_->dump(timestamp);
#endif
++timestamp;
}
void Simulator::avs_driver() {
//--
}
void Simulator::ccip_driver() {
//--
}
